Transaction 1852a3cb7cce1768cc782d2651630ce1840f321514f2b5c553430844dde5e909

2 Input
2 Outputs
  • 1852a3cb7cce1768cc782d2651630ce1840f321514f2b5c553430844dde5e909:0
  • value  139366
    address  1HWqsgnSd12Gv8SpoUMi1Cj8hp79BTSpW7
  • 1852a3cb7cce1768cc782d2651630ce1840f321514f2b5c553430844dde5e909:1
  • value  76930000
    address  1Ag2qsi91DnHrEsusWGFhLfodGCMqnuwJo